- Aug 15 – Aug 21
Festa de Gràcia
A week-long neighborhood festival in Gràcia featuring elaborate street decorations, live music, and various activities. — Free entry; some events may require prior registration.

Public holidays & closures in August 2026
On these dates banks, government offices, and many attractions in Spain close or switch to holiday hours. Worth checking before you pin a must-see to one of them.
- Aug 15
Assumption
Assumption (Asunción)
